摘要
为了有效估计智能天线系统中来自相关信号源的信号到达方向,提出了一种共轭倒序向量平均的算法,该方法是对二维旋转不变技术的信号参数估计算法的改进。数值实验结果表明,改进算法在不增加计算机资源占用的基础上,既能估计独立信号源的信号到达方向,也能有效地估计相关信号源的信号到达方向。
In order to estimate the signal direction of arrival from correlated signal sources in smart antenna system,an algorithm is proposed,which is named conjectured vector of inversed order.The algorithm is from modified two-dimensional estimating signal parameters via the rotational invariance technique.Numerical experiment shows that the proposed algorithm can estimate the signal direction of arrival from independent signal sources efficiently.Furthermore,it can estimate the signal direction of arrival from correlated signal sources without additional computer resources obviously.
